Transaction dda146d99649321c69c33ffb9dfe6e870a438fdc38e67243989176dc3f8673db
1 Input
1 Output
-
dda146d99649321c69c33ffb9dfe6e870a438fdc38e67243989176dc3f8673db:0
- value
- 569298
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d31f467530201eb734c291a71408895e5403fbb
- address
- bc1q85clge6nqgq7ku6v9yd8zsygjhj5q0amjeszc9